HomeSort by relevance Sort by last modified time
    Searched refs:LiveIns (Results 1 - 25 of 47) sorted by null

1 2

  /external/swiftshader/third_party/LLVM/lib/CodeGen/
MachineRegisterInfo.cpp 220 for (unsigned i = 0, e = LiveIns.size(); i != e; ++i)
221 if (LiveIns[i].second) {
222 if (use_empty(LiveIns[i].second)) {
228 LiveIns.erase(LiveIns.begin() + i);
233 TII.get(TargetOpcode::COPY), LiveIns[i].second)
234 .addReg(LiveIns[i].first);
237 EntryMBB->addLiveIn(LiveIns[i].first);
241 EntryMBB->addLiveIn(LiveIns[i].first);
  /external/llvm/lib/CodeGen/
MachineRegisterInfo.cpp 148 for (auto &I : LiveIns)
402 for (unsigned i = 0, e = LiveIns.size(); i != e; ++i)
403 if (LiveIns[i].second) {
404 if (use_empty(LiveIns[i].second)) {
410 LiveIns.erase(LiveIns.begin() + i);
415 TII.get(TargetOpcode::COPY), LiveIns[i].second)
416 .addReg(LiveIns[i].first);
419 EntryMBB->addLiveIn(LiveIns[i].first);
423 EntryMBB->addLiveIn(LiveIns[i].first)
    [all...]
MachineBasicBlock.cpp 327 LiveIns.begin(), LiveIns.end(),
329 if (I == LiveIns.end())
334 LiveIns.erase(I);
339 LiveIns.begin(), LiveIns.end(),
345 std::sort(LiveIns.begin(), LiveIns.end(),
349 // Liveins are sorted by physreg now we can merge their lanemasks.
350 LiveInVector::const_iterator I = LiveIns.begin()
    [all...]
  /external/swiftshader/third_party/LLVM/include/llvm/CodeGen/
MachineRegisterInfo.h 61 /// LiveIns/LiveOuts - Keep track of the physical registers that are
66 std::vector<std::pair<unsigned, unsigned> > LiveIns;
302 LiveIns.push_back(std::make_pair(Reg, vreg));
311 livein_iterator livein_begin() const { return LiveIns.begin(); }
312 livein_iterator livein_end() const { return LiveIns.end(); }
313 bool livein_empty() const { return LiveIns.empty(); }
MachineBasicBlock.h 81 /// LiveIns - Keep track of the physical registers that are livein of
83 std::vector<unsigned> LiveIns;
204 void addLiveIn(unsigned Reg) { LiveIns.push_back(Reg); }
217 livein_iterator livein_begin() const { return LiveIns.begin(); }
218 livein_iterator livein_end() const { return LiveIns.end(); }
219 bool livein_empty() const { return LiveIns.empty(); }
  /external/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 106 LiveInVector LiveIns;
289 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
292 LiveIns.push_back(RegMaskPair);
295 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
314 livein_iterator livein_begin() const { return LiveIns.begin(); }
315 livein_iterator livein_end() const { return LiveIns.end(); }
316 bool livein_empty() const { return LiveIns.empty(); }
317 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 123 std::vector<std::pair<unsigned, unsigned> > LiveIns;
793 LiveIns.push_back(std::make_pair(Reg, vreg));
800 livein_iterator livein_begin() const { return LiveIns.begin(); }
801 livein_iterator livein_end() const { return LiveIns.end(); }
802 bool livein_empty() const { return LiveIns.empty(); }
    [all...]
MachineTraceMetrics.h 216 SmallVector<LiveInReg, 4> LiveIns;
  /prebuilts/clang/host/darwin-x86/clang-3957855/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
MachineTraceMetrics.h 218 SmallVector<LiveInReg, 4> LiveIns;
  /prebuilts/clang/host/darwin-x86/clang-3960126/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
  /prebuilts/clang/host/darwin-x86/clang-3977809/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
  /prebuilts/clang/host/darwin-x86/clang-4053586/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
  /prebuilts/clang/host/linux-x86/clang-3957855/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
  /prebuilts/clang/host/linux-x86/clang-3960126/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
  /prebuilts/clang/host/linux-x86/clang-3977809/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]
  /prebuilts/clang/host/linux-x86/clang-4053586/prebuilt_include/llvm/include/llvm/CodeGen/
MachineBasicBlock.h 92 LiveInVector LiveIns;
281 LiveIns.push_back(RegisterMaskPair(PhysReg, LaneMask));
284 LiveIns.push_back(RegMaskPair);
287 /// Sorts and uniques the LiveIns vector. It can be significantly faster to do
316 livein_iterator livein_begin_dbg() const { return LiveIns.begin(); }
322 livein_iterator livein_end() const { return LiveIns.end(); }
323 bool livein_empty() const { return LiveIns.empty(); }
324 iterator_range<livein_iterator> liveins() const { function in class:llvm::MachineBasicBlock
    [all...]
MachineRegisterInfo.h 136 std::vector<std::pair<unsigned, unsigned>> LiveIns;
    [all...]

Completed in 1133 milliseconds

1 2